Strategic Healthcare Initiatives & Musculoskeletal Care in Fiji

Fiji's strategic position as the clinical hub of the South Pacific entails significant responsibility in managing both localized and regional patient demographics. Historically, medical centers across the major divisions—Central (Suva), Western (Lautoka), and Northern (Labasa)—have faced distinct challenges in delivering advanced diagnostic imaging. The high prevalence of non-communicable diseases (NCDs), particularly diabetic complications leading to lower extremity pathology, alongside orthopedic trauma from sports (such as Rugby Union) and agricultural activities, has driven an unprecedented demand for localized, high-resolution diagnostic imaging.

Implementing Orthopedic Specialty MRI Scanners in Fiji addresses a critical gap in Point-of-Care (POC) Diagnostics. Standard body MRI machines are frequently backlogged with general neurology and oncology cases. By exporting specialized extremity scanners, Wenzhou Aert Medical equips local hospitals to divert hand, foot, knee, and elbow imaging to dedicated systems, reducing general wait times and accelerating targeted orthopedic treatments.

Additionally, Fiji's tropical climate—characterized by high humidity, salt air, and sudden power fluctuations—demands diagnostic machinery that combines engineering resilience with intelligent protection mechanisms. High-performance, low-maintenance MRI systems are no longer luxury acquisitions; they are foundational requirements for sustainable public health infrastructure in the Pacific.

About Wenzhou Aert Medical Co., Ltd.

Wenzhou Aert Medical Co., Ltd. is a high-tech enterprise focused on the research, development, production, and sales of mobile CT, mobile MRI, and digital X-ray detectors. Headquartered in Wenzhou, Zhejiang Province, the company has multiple research and development centers and collaborates with renowned domestic and international scientific research institutions and universities to drive the advancement of intelligent medical devices globally.

Products and Applications

The company is dedicated to providing mobile CT and mobile MRI solutions for various application scenarios, breaking through the core technologies of traditional devices and continuously upgrading them. Our equipment is widely applicable in hospital bedside, ambulance, mobile medical vehicles, and battlefield medical care, meeting the diagnostic needs in complex environments. Our mobile CT products are characterized by low radiation, easy mobility, simple operation, and high-definition image quality. They are extensively used in orthopedics, joint care, chest care, stroke, and other clinical specialties, greatly improving diagnostic efficiency and patient treatment experience.

Research and Technological Advancements

Aert Medical has independently developed the "LingTong" and "Ark" mobile CT series, each with distinct technical directions. These products, with their low radiation, mobility, high-quality images, and ease of use, meet the diagnostic needs in various clinical settings, including hospitals, health check-up centers, and emergency rescue scenarios. Our self-developed "Automation Balance System" has seamlessly integrated CBCT technology with spiral CT technology, which is expected to elevate CBCT performance to be comparable to 64-slice spiral CT.

In addition, Aert Medical is actively developing a low-field mobile MRI, which is not only compact, with short scanning times, but also offers complete scanning sequences and high image quality, enabling quick diagnosis of the head, spine, joints, and breast. Our upcoming ultra-low-field head mobile MRI will be widely used in neurosurgical operating rooms to provide precise surgical navigation and diagnostic support for stroke patients.

Tailored Local Solutions & Regional Compliance

Deploying state-of-the-art MRI scanners to Fiji requires strict alignment with local healthcare authorities. Wenzhou Aert Medical coordinates directly with hospitals and governmental health divisions to offer equipment fully compliant with regional power grids, marine environmental conditions, and personnel availability.

1. Power Grid Stabilizing Configurations

Many remote clinics in Fiji encounter irregular voltage spikes or dropouts. Our scanning configurations come integrated with uninterruptible heavy-duty medical power regulators and power surge protectors, ensuring scanner longevity and protecting delicate imaging hardware from damage.

2. Specialized Anti-Corrosion Engineering

Fiji's maritime environment introduces high salt content into the atmosphere. Left unprotected, sensitive scanner circuitry and coil connections deteriorate. Wenzhou Aert Medical applies specialized polyurethane-based conformal coatings to internal components, ensuring long-term durability in tropical environments.

3. Comprehensive Staff Training and Tele-Radiology

Training specialized radiologists in Fiji can be challenging. By integrating Aert’s AI-powered automated scan sequencing and standardizing digital interfaces, scanning steps are simplified. Tele-radiology modules transmit raw DICOM files via secure cloud portals to global networks, allowing quick collaborative diagnostics.

How do helium-free MRI scanners benefit healthcare clinics across Fiji's maritime regions?
Traditional superconducting MRI systems consume liquid helium to cool the magnets, requiring periodic refills that present a significant logistical challenge in the South Pacific due to remote supply chains. Helium-free systems mitigate this operational bottleneck by eliminating the need for periodic refills, reducing long-term maintenance costs and keeping systems online.

How does the 3D Foot Scanner connect to prosthetic manufacturing systems?
Our 3D foot scanners generate industry-standard STL, OBJ, and PLY files, ensuring direct compatibility with orthotic design software and 3D printing equipment. This allows orthopedic clinics in Fiji to digitize their workflow, from scanning to insole production.
